Irritable Bowel Syndrome: when stress, worries and unhealthy eating habits affect the intestines

Irritable Bowel Syndrome: when stress, worries and unhealthy eating habits affect the intestines

It’s familiar to us all: an important or unpleasant appointment is coming up, or perhaps there’s no time to eat in peace in the office because there’s just too much work. Before we know it, our intestines start to respond with abdominal pain, flatulence or irregular bowel movements, whether in the form of constipation or diarrhoea. If this happens again and again, the diagnosis of irritable bowel syndrome is very common.
